The Chief Minister today spoke with Nigel Farage, the leader of Reform UK and one of its Members of Parliament.
This exchange followed an interview conducted by Mr Farage with the Chief Minister on Thursday evening on his programme on GB News. Today’s conversation offered an opportunity to speak at a political level, rather than in the context of a media interview.
The Chief Minister outlined the logic behind the proposed UK–EU agreement in respect of Gibraltar, setting out the structure and intent of the agreement in broad terms from Gibraltar’s perspective.
Mr Picardo and Mr Farage agreed to meet in London at an early opportunity to continue their discussions. The Chief Minister will use that occasion to further set out the position of the Government of Gibraltar and explain why this agreement represents the best possible outcome for Gibraltar following the United Kingdom’s departure from the European Union.
